Minimum and Trigger Prices for Export Lamb (No. 2463, Ag. 4/52/3/1)
PURSUANT to section 14 (2) of the Meat Export Prices Act 1976, notice is hereby given that:
(a) The Meat Export Prices Committee has determined that the minimum and trigger prices for the bench mark grade of lamb intended for export to apply during the remainder of the 1980-81 season shall be as follows:
| Category of Meat | Bench Mark Grade | Minimum Price (cents per kilogram) | Trigger Price (cents per kilogram)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Lamb | PM (13 to 16 kg) | 113 | 155 |
(b) This notice is to take effect from and inclusive of the 13th day of October 1980.
Dated at Wellington this 3rd day of October 1980. ALAN DANKS, Chairman, Meat Export Prices Committee.
Notice by Examiner of Commercial Practices of Consent to a Merger and Takeover Proposal
PURSUANT to section 69 of the Commerce Act 1975, the Examiner of Commercial Practices hereby gives notice of the following merger and takeover proposal to which he has consented.
Person by or on behalf of whom notice was given in terms of section 68 (1) of the Commerce Act 1975 Proposal Date of Consent
Colin Giltrap Motors Ltd. Colin Giltrap Motors Ltd., may acquire up to 51 percent of the ordinary and preference capital of Midland Coachlines Ltd. 30 September 1980
Dated at Wellington this 2nd day of October 1980. A. E. MONAGHAN, Examiner of Commercial Practices.
